Scott and Swarup's regular neighbourhood as a tree of cylinders

Let G be a finitely presented group. Scott and Swarup have constructed a canonical splitting of G which encloses all almost invariant sets over virtually polycyclic subgroups of a given length. We give an alternative construction of this regular neighbourhood, by showing that it is the tree of cylinders of a JSJ splitting.
